Munich - The Munich general practitioner Markus Frühwein and his colleagues inoculate around 100 doses of corona vaccine every week. “Depending on how much we get,” he says. The large Munich practice with several doctors is well above average. But: "We could vaccinate more," says Frühwein. At Astrazeneca *, the need for advice among its patients is significantly higher. And since the prioritization of the vaccine was lifted and it was released for all age groups, the phone has been ringing even more often in his practice. "It was almost impossible to handle the many calls," said Frühwein yesterday afternoon. That's what many general practitioners are doing right now. But many who were now hoping for a faster vaccination will have to wait a little longer. The most important questions.

Coronavirus: Astrazeneca vaccination in Bavaria - answers to the most important questions

Do you not need the existing Astrazeneca vaccine in the practices for people over the age of 60?

Apparently only in part.

The Standing Vaccination Commission (Stiko) recommends Astrazeneca from the age of 60.

But from the practices and vaccination centers the feedback comes more and more often that the "previously intended age group over 60 years is already vaccinated or does not want to have the Astrazeneca vaccine for various reasons", says a spokesman for the Association of Statutory Health Insurance Physicians in Bavaria (KVB) of our newspaper .

The clearance now opens up the possibility of giving the vaccine to younger people if they want to and from a medical point of view nothing speaks against it.

In this way, possible waste can also be prevented.

The measure was therefore a logical step for Bavaria's Minister of Health, Klaus Holetschek (CSU).

The special vaccination campaigns in the vaccination centers had shown: "There are many people in Bavaria outside of the priority groups who are very interested in a vaccination * and also want to take Astrazeneca," he told our newspaper.

If you give the doctor's practices more freedom here, you help everyone. 

Corona in Bavaria - How much Astrazeneca vaccine do doctors' offices have?

So far, the total amount of vaccines has been manageable. For the coming week, the contract doctors of the National Association of Statutory Health Insurance Physicians (KBV) could each order up to 48 doses. The Federal Ministry of Health determines which vaccine they receive. If - as for this week - around 55,000 practices order again, each of them will receive an average of 36 cans, according to the KBV. What sounds little is after all twice as much as in the previous week.


Curious: Ironically, during the week in which Bavaria's Minister of Health Klaus Holetschek (CSU) releases Astrazeneca in medical practices for all age groups, they could not order this product at all. That means: next week the practices will not receive an Astrazeneca. Instead, only Biontech should be supplied, for which the prioritization continues to apply. Although individual doctors report that they still have unvaccinated Astrazeneca in stock - this seems to be very different from region to region. Overall, the total supply of approved vaccines is likely to be scarce for the time being. Jens Spahn's (CDU) house has not yet communicated how much and what vaccine the Federal Ministry of Health has delivered to the practices in May. "This ambiguity is a nuisance," says the KVB spokesman.

Should I contact my doctor if I want to be vaccinated with Astrazeneca?

The Association of Statutory Health Insurance Physicians in Bavaria (KVB) advises you to stay calm and wait and see. "Nobody benefits if the phone lines of the practices are now occupied by those willing to vaccinate," says the spokesman. After all, the standard supply outside of Corona should not be lost sight of. Mediziner Frühwein also points out that the practices always only find out at the end of the week how much vaccine they will receive for the next week. “Asking for appointments in the middle of the week therefore makes absolutely no sense.” In fact, however, some practices keep lists of patients who want to be vaccinated. From the patient's point of view, it can't hurt to show your interest when you get the chance, even if it might take some time for this wish to come true. The KVB also says: "If you are at the doctor's anyway, it makes senseto inquire about a vaccination. "

How long does it take to get the second Astrazeneca vaccination?

Anyone who is vaccinated with Astrazeneca in Bavaria will receive the second vaccination twelve weeks later.

At Biontech and Moderna, the gap is six weeks.

The Johnson & Johnson vaccine only needs to be injected once.

These distances could become relevant when fully vaccinated people get back their liberties.

For example, Greece recently suspended quarantine for EU tourists who have been fully vaccinated for two weeks or who have a negative PCR test *.

How often do thromboses occur after an Astrazeneca vaccination?

According to the Paul Ehrlich Institute, 59 cases of sinus and cerebral vein thrombosis after vaccination with Astrazeneca had been reported in Germany by mid-April.

Twelve people died, six men and six women.

According to the Robert Koch Institute (RKI), a total of more than 4.2 million first doses and 4153 second doses of the vaccine had been administered up to and including April 15.
